GMM 62 modules/imgproc/src/grabcut.cpp GMM( Mat& _model ); GMM 87 modules/imgproc/src/grabcut.cpp GMM::GMM( Mat& _model ) GMM 109 modules/imgproc/src/grabcut.cpp double GMM::operator()( const Vec3d color ) const GMM 117 modules/imgproc/src/grabcut.cpp double GMM::operator()( int ci, const Vec3d color ) const GMM 134 modules/imgproc/src/grabcut.cpp int GMM::whichComponent( const Vec3d color ) const GMM 151 modules/imgproc/src/grabcut.cpp void GMM::initLearning() GMM 164 modules/imgproc/src/grabcut.cpp void GMM::addSample( int ci, const Vec3d color ) GMM 174 modules/imgproc/src/grabcut.cpp void GMM::endLearning() GMM 208 modules/imgproc/src/grabcut.cpp void GMM::calcInverseCovAndDeterm( int ci ) GMM 361 modules/imgproc/src/grabcut.cpp static void initGMMs( const Mat& img, const Mat& mask, GMM& bgdGMM, GMM& fgdGMM ) GMM 381 modules/imgproc/src/grabcut.cpp kmeans( _bgdSamples, GMM::componentsCount, bgdLabels, GMM 384 modules/imgproc/src/grabcut.cpp kmeans( _fgdSamples, GMM::componentsCount, fgdLabels, GMM 401 modules/imgproc/src/grabcut.cpp static void assignGMMsComponents( const Mat& img, const Mat& mask, const GMM& bgdGMM, const GMM& fgdGMM, Mat& compIdxs ) GMM 418 modules/imgproc/src/grabcut.cpp static void learnGMMs( const Mat& img, const Mat& mask, const Mat& compIdxs, GMM& bgdGMM, GMM& fgdGMM ) GMM 423 modules/imgproc/src/grabcut.cpp for( int ci = 0; ci < GMM::componentsCount; ci++ ) GMM 446 modules/imgproc/src/grabcut.cpp static void constructGCGraph( const Mat& img, const Mat& mask, const GMM& bgdGMM, const GMM& fgdGMM, double lambda, GMM 542 modules/imgproc/src/grabcut.cpp GMM bgdGMM( bgdModel ), fgdGMM( fgdModel ); GMM 462 modules/video/src/bgfg_gaussmix2.cpp const GMM* gmm, const float* mean, GMM 470 modules/video/src/bgfg_gaussmix2.cpp GMM g = gmm[mode]; GMM 525 modules/video/src/bgfg_gaussmix2.cpp GMM* _gmm, float* _mean, GMM 569 modules/video/src/bgfg_gaussmix2.cpp GMM* gmm = gmm0 + ncols*nmixtures*y; GMM 738 modules/video/src/bgfg_gaussmix2.cpp GMM* gmm0; GMM 847 modules/video/src/bgfg_gaussmix2.cpp bgmodel.ptr<GMM>(), GMM 848 modules/video/src/bgfg_gaussmix2.cpp (float*)(bgmodel.ptr() + sizeof(GMM)*nmixtures*image.rows*image.cols), GMM 871 modules/video/src/bgfg_gaussmix2.cpp const GMM* gmm = bgmodel.ptr<GMM>(); GMM 882 modules/video/src/bgfg_gaussmix2.cpp GMM gaussian = gmm[gaussianIdx];